WAB CLUB FEATURE: Pleasanton Table Tennis Center

(by Steve Hopkins)

Pleasanton Table Tennis Center is located at the center of Pleasanton, California to the East of San Francisco Bay with quick access to I-580 and I-680 (and each of the major cities in the area).

Pleasanton Table Tennis Center was the first table tennis club in tri-valley to open every day. The club is currently open Tuesday through Thursday from 1-10p, Friday/Saturday 1-11p, and Sunday from 1-6p.

The club boasts professional table tennis flooring, great lighting, plenty of space, Butterfly tables and barriers, and a pro shop.  There is a Saturday league (visit their new online league signup), coaching available from elite players/coaches, and camps including a large summer camp each year.
